Silicon macs are newer with Apple M1, M2, M3, M4 chips, Intel is the older type of chip. Not sure which kind of Mac you have? Click the Apple menu > About This Mac, and check the Processor / Chip label. See more info here if you need help figuring out which version is right for your computer.
Requires MacOS v12 (Monterey) or later.

Installing Layout Department
To install, click the download button above while you are on your computer. A file called Layout Department.dmg will start downloading. When it’s ready, click on it to open the file. That will show you a screen where you drag the app icon into the Applications folder.
After that, there will be a popup that says you downloaded the app from this website, layoutdepartment.com, and that Apple has checked it for malicious software and none was detected. Click the open button.
Updating Layout Department to the latest version
Once you have the app installed, keeping up to date with the latest version is pretty simple. Unless something goes wrong, you shouldn’t need to come back here to the website to download the file each time by clicking the button and going through the install process. Instead, Layout Department checks for updates and downloads them in the background each time you start the app. Once a new version is ready, it will give you a little notification.
If you already have the app open and want to check for updates, you can go to the top menu and choose Layout Department > Check for Updates.
If you want to see what version you are using, you can go to the top menu and select Layout Department > About Layout Department and a little box will pop up and show you the version number.
About security and privacy
Here’s more about the app, and there are more security/privacy notes in the FAQ there. The main thing to know is that all your files are processed locally on your computer, and they are not uploaded to the internet.
